The Impact of a Psychological Program on the Development of Physical Abilities of Combat Sports Practitioners at the National Sports High School: The Case of Male Athletes, Class of 2019/2020

The objective of our study is to demonstrate the effect of a psychological program on the development of physical abilities through a comparative analysis of results, highlighting the impact of the psychological aspect on performance improvement. The study includes 16 combat sports athletes from the National Sports High School who followed the same training program, except that half of these athletes did not receive psychological support. The other eight athletes, however, had a psychological program tailored to their individual profiles and training conditions. Next, various tests were administered using the Myotest device. The comparative analysis of the athletes' results reveals a significant difference in the average scores of the assessed physical qualities. Our study confirms that the presence of a psychological program is a crucial method for ensuring the development of an athlete's performance level.
